Aged Cannabis Profiles

Aged cannabis profiles refer to cannabis flower and concentrate samples that have undergone extended storage—typically months to years—resulting in measurable changes to cannabinoid and terpene composition. Over time, THCa gradually decarboxylates to THC, while minor cannabinoids like CBN accumulate and terpene profiles shift due to oxidation and volatilization. Breeders and seed banks study aged samples to understand stability, degradation patterns, and how specific genetic lineages behave under storage conditions. This data informs preservation strategies, shelf-life expectations, and which cultivars maintain desired chemical profiles longest. Aging research has become increasingly relevant as the industry develops standardized storage protocols and consumers seek longevity information for seed collections and flower preservation.

Breeder relevance

Breeders examine aged plant material to assess genetic stability, terpene retention, and cannabinoid conversion rates—traits valuable for developing cultivars suited to long-term storage. Understanding how parent lines age helps inform crosses aimed at producing more chemically stable offspring for seed banks and collectors.
